Output 43fb63e618db1affaff64d6db3ffb78c07eb610495bca66d830f5915593143ef:14

value
150290
script pubkey
OP_0 OP_PUSHBYTES_20 6b19403c608d823f041c02e7dab071e43eaca2d0
address
bc1qdvv5q0rq3kpr7pquqtna4vr3usl2egksxe79x6
transaction
43fb63e618db1affaff64d6db3ffb78c07eb610495bca66d830f5915593143ef
spent
true